Using Feature Phones to Promote Literacy and Scripture Engagement
Author: Cynthia Trotter (2020)
 

“…many of the people in the language communities in Chad do not own an Android phone. Yes, some day Android phones will be more prevalent, and their numbers are growing, albeit slowly. But we are interested in what we can do with the phones many people have right now: feature phones. Even a feature phone can be used to promote reading as well as listening to Scripture!”

Cynthia Trotter describes three different ways of promoting literacy and Scripture engagement using feature phones:

  1. Easy reader video books: created using PowerPoint slides, text in a large font size, with an image and audio recording for each slide. The presentation can be exported as a video and converted to a format viewable on feature phones.
  2. Go Bible: a Java app, usable on feature phones that support Java.
  3. PhotoBible: a set of pictures, each containing two or three verses.
